You might encounter the error "Spooler Subsystem App stopped working and was closed" in Windows XP and Windows Vista, And the printer is usually HP which causes the printer spooler to stop. Try the following to resolve Spooler Subsystem App stopped working and was closed error. Check the windows service.
Click on start > Run and type in services. Scroll down to the “Printer Spooler” service, Right click on this service and select start. Click the general tab and make sure the service startup is set to automatic, Click on the recovery tab and select “Restart the service” for all three drop down boxes. Now if the spooler subsystem app stopped working your system will try three times to restart the printer spooler service. Turn off Internet Print Client. Click Start > Control Panel > Programs and Features, In the left side, Click "Turn Windows features on or off" Click + sign of Print services, Check Mark and select LPD and LPR.
You should remove the check box against "Internet Printing Client". Restart your PC. Then click start > run and type in eventvwr and hit enter, Now search the logs for any spooler errors you might have. Uninstall and Re- Install Your Printers.
Deleting and re- installing your printers will “Refresh” the printer settings. Click Start > Control Panel > Printers > Right Click on all printers one at a time and select delete. Then add each printer back one at a time printing test pages if possible after you add every printer to see if the Subsystem App stopped working and was closed error comes back. If the error does come back for a certain printer try to update the drivers as per below.

Update Printer Drivers. Take a look at what driver your printer is using, Click Start > Control Panel > Printers > Right Click on all printers one at a time and select properties, Note down what driver the printer is using. Now download the latest driver for that printer and install it on your computer.
Q & A For Subsystem App stopped working and was closed. Q : I don’t have the run option in my start menu. A : if you don't have Run in the Start Menu then hold the Windows Key on the keyboard and press R. More Info. Print Spooler Service Keeps Stopping.
